Here's how to take screenshots on smartwatches running Wear OS: a simple guide for everyone

Perhaps for many users it will be taken for granted but for others it will not. It may happen that you need to make one at a given moment screenshot of the smartwatch. Well, Wear OS allows us to do this in a very simple way and with a few simple gestures. Clearly the prerequisite for taking a screenshot is have the application of the same name on your smartphone to which we will have connected the smartwatch. Once you have made sure that this is installed on our device, do as follows:

  • on the smartwatch, let's take the screen we want to capture with a screenshot
  • now we take our smartphone and, with the application open, we go to press on the three dots at the top right
  • in the menu that opens, we will see several options including Disconnect smartwatch, Report a bug and so on. There we will also find Take a screenshot of the clock
  • click on the option and that's it
  • once the screenshot is captured we will receive a notification on the smartphone in the top curtain

How will the screenshots look like?

The question everyone is asking: and now the screenshot how did it come? Rectangular like a smartphone screen or round? The answer is simple: the image capture will be in the same shape as the clock. So if we have a Oppo watchfor example, the screenshot will be a square with square capture; de we have a We Watch instead, the screenshot will be a square with the round capture.
